Pecna is a village located in Poland, specifically within the Greater Poland Voivodeship. Its geographic coordinates are 52.18333° N latitude and 16.8000° E longitude, placing it in the western part of Poland. This location is characterized by its proximity to the larger city of Poznań, which is known for its historical significance and cultural heritage.
Pecna is primarily known for its agricultural landscape and rural community. The village is part of the Gmina Kórnik, which emphasizes local governance and community engagement. Timezone in Pecna
Pecna is located in the Europe/Warsaw timezone, which operates at a UTC offset of +1 hour during standard time. This means that when it is noon in Coordinated Universal Time (UTC), it is 1 PM in Pecna. During daylight saving time, which typically runs from the last Sunday in March to the last Sunday in October, the offset shifts to UTC +2 hours.
